How to Measure Your GEO vs SEO Overlap (the Honest Way)

To measure your GEO vs SEO overlap honestly, match sources query by query rather than pooling them. For each real buyer query, collect Google’s top 10 organic domains and the domains AI cites, then compute what share of AI-cited domains also rank in Google for that same query, and average those shares. In my AI Search Visibility Benchmark the aggregate looked like 165 of roughly 500 domains overlapping, but the per-query average was only about 22%. The aggregate count overstated alignment. Per-query matching is the method that tells the truth.

Why domain-level counts mislead

This is the trap, so it goes first. The tempting metric is a single big number: how many unique domains show up in both your Google rankings and your AI citations across the whole study. In my benchmark that count was 165 shared domains out of roughly 500. It sounds like meaningful alignment.

It is not, really. An aggregate count pools every domain across every query. So a domain that ranks in Google for query A and gets AI-cited for an unrelated query B still lands in the overlap bucket, even though no single buyer search ever saw both. The number answers “do these domains ever appear on both surfaces anywhere” when the question you actually care about is “for this query, does what Google ranks match what AI cites.” Those are different questions, and only the second one maps to a buyer’s experience.

When I switched to per-query matching, the honest figure dropped to about 22%. That gap, 165 domains of apparent overlap versus 22% real per-query overlap, is the whole reason to measure carefully. If you report the aggregate, you will likely overstate how much your SEO work carries into AI answers.

Step by step: how to measure it

1. Build a prompt set of real buyer queries

Start with the questions your buyers actually type, not head keywords from a volume tool. Pull them from sales calls, support tickets, your search console, and the “people also ask” patterns in your category. Aim for a few dozen to start, spread across the categories you want to win. Phrase them the way a buyer would ask an assistant, in natural language, because that is what AI engines respond to.

2. Collect Google’s top 10 per query

For each query, capture the top 10 organic results and record the domains. At any scale beyond a handful of queries, automate this with a SERP API such as Apify, which returns structured organic results you can store cleanly. Decide up front what you exclude, typically ads, maps packs and other non-organic blocks, and keep that rule consistent. Note separately whether an AI Overview appeared, since that is its own signal worth tracking.

3. Collect AI citations per query

Run the same queries through the AI engines your buyers use, in my case ChatGPT and Perplexity, and record the domains each one cites. Capture the cited source list, not just whether you were mentioned. Keep the engine list fixed across runs so results stay comparable. 4. Match per query, then compute overlap

This is the step that separates an honest measurement from a vanity one. For each query, take the set of AI-cited domains and the set of Google top-10 domains, and find the intersection for that query only. Then compute the per-query overlap as the share of that query’s AI-cited domains that also rank in Google for the same query. Average those per-query shares across the whole prompt set. That average, about 22% in my benchmark, is your headline metric.

5. Pull the AI-only and Google-only sets

The non-overlap is where the insight lives. For each query, list the domains AI cites that Google does not rank (your GEO opportunity surface) and the domains Google ranks that AI never cites (organic strength not translating to AI). Across my sample, established category brands turned up in the AI-only set despite not ranking, which directionally suggests entity authority drives citations differently than on-page SEO drives rankings. 6. Report AI Overview presence

Track, per query, whether Google showed an AI Overview at all. It is a useful third column because it hints at where Google itself is shifting toward generated answers, and it can change over time independently of both your rankings and your AI citations.

What to do with the result

A low per-query overlap, like my 22%, is the practical case for treating GEO as its own discipline rather than a byproduct of SEO. If most of what AI cites for a query is not what Google ranks for that query, then optimizing only for Google leaves most of the AI answer untouched. Use the AI-only set as your GEO target list and the Google-only set as a reminder of organic strength that is not yet translating.

FAQ

How do you measure GEO vs SEO overlap? Build a prompt set of real buyer queries, collect Google’s top 10 (via a SERP API like Apify) and AI citations (ChatGPT and Perplexity) per query, match per query, and average the per-query overlap. In my benchmark that averaged about 22%, despite 165 of roughly 500 domains overlapping in aggregate.

Why are domain-level overlap counts misleading? Aggregate counts pool domains across all queries, so a domain ranking for one query and AI-cited for another still counts as overlap. That inflated alignment to 165 shared domains, while per-query matching showed only about 22%. Per-query is the honest metric.

What tools do I need? A SERP API such as Apify to capture Google top 10 at scale, access to the AI engines your buyers use to collect cited domains, and a spreadsheet to store per-query lists and compute overlap.

How many queries do I need? A few dozen real buyer queries across your core categories is a reasonable start, and a couple of hundred steadies the per-query average. Treat any single run as directional, since AI answers shift by run, account, region and phrasing.
